React Native Desktop features and specs

  • Cross-Platform Code Sharing
    React Native Desktop allows for code sharing between mobile and desktop platforms, reducing development time and effort. This promotes a unified codebase across iOS, Android, and macOS platforms.
  • React Ecosystem
    Developers can leverage the extensive ecosystem of React and React Native, including libraries, tools, and community support, thus simplifying development and benefiting from existing solutions.
  • Hot Reloading
    React Native Desktop supports hot reloading, which allows developers to see changes immediately without rebuilding the whole application. This greatly enhances development speed and productivity.
  • Native Performance
    React Native Desktop aims to deliver a performance close to native applications on macOS, allowing for smooth user experience and efficient utilization of the system's resources.

Possible disadvantages of React Native Desktop

  • Immature Project
    React Native Desktop is still a relatively young project compared to its mobile counterpart. It may lack some stability, advanced features, and support that are available in more mature frameworks.
  • Learning Curve
    Developers familiar with only web development might find it challenging to adapt to React Native's paradigms and native coding patterns required for desktop applications.
  • Limited macOS-Specific Components
    There might be fewer out-of-the-box components and libraries tailored for macOS when compared to those available for mobile, requiring more custom implementation work.
  • No Official Support
    As an open-source project, React Native Desktop doesn't have official support from Facebook or a large organization, which might lead to slower updates and a greater reliance on community contributions.

Analysis of React Native Desktop

Overall verdict

  • React Native Desktop can be a good choice if you are already invested in the React Native ecosystem and are looking for a way to expand your application's reach to desktop platforms without starting from scratch. It benefits from the familiar JavaScript and React syntax, as well as a large community of developers who contribute to its growth. However, depending on the project's specific needs and the level of maturity expected, it might lack some features or optimizations available in native desktop application frameworks.

Why this product is good

  • React Native Desktop is designed to allow developers to use React Native for creating desktop applications. It leverages the existing React Native ecosystem, which means that developers familiar with React Native can transition to desktop app development more easily. By allowing code sharing between mobile and desktop platforms, it can significantly reduce the development time and effort required to maintain consistency across platforms.

Recommended for

    This framework is recommended for JavaScript developers who are already comfortable with React Native and want to leverage their existing skills to develop cross-platform applications that include desktop environments. It is suitable for projects that require rapid prototyping and consistent user experiences across mobile and desktop devices.
